Hair Loss Is Often a Symptom, Not the Root Problem

When hair begins shedding, the temptation is to focus only on the scalp. But hair follicles are living structures influenced by nutrition, hormones, illness, stress, medications, energy intake, thyroid function, and overall metabolic health.

In my case, the shedding was connected to low iron and hormonal changes. At the same time, years of styling, coloring, heat, and normal wear had damaged the hair shaft itself.

These were two separate problems:

  • Hair loss was happening at the follicle.
  • Hair damage was happening along the existing strand.

That distinction completely changed my approach.

Correcting My Low Iron Was Foundational

Iron is required for hemoglobin production and oxygen transport. Hair follicles are metabolically active, and iron deficiency is commonly considered when someone develops diffuse shedding or telogen effluvium.

I did not start taking large amounts of iron on my own. Iron can accumulate in the body, and excessive supplementation can be harmful. I used blood work to evaluate my iron status and followed my levels over time.

Why Low Testosterone Mattered for Me

Hormones affect hair in complex ways. Too much androgen activity can worsen pattern hair loss in genetically susceptible people, but very low sex-hormone levels may also occur alongside menopause-related changes in skin, muscle, energy, and hair quality.

My own testing showed that my testosterone was low. Working with a knowledgeable medical professional, I incorporated hormone replacement therapy that included testosterone.

This part must be individualized. Testosterone is not a universal treatment for female hair loss, and too much can potentially worsen scalp hair loss, acne, or unwanted facial hair. The dose, symptoms, blood levels, androgen sensitivity, and pattern of hair loss all matter.

For me, correcting a documented deficiency was part of restoring my overall hormonal health. It was not something I treated as a standalone hair-growth drug.

I Made High-Quality Animal Protein a Priority

Hair is made primarily from keratin, a structural protein. The body therefore needs a dependable supply of amino acids to build new hair.

This sounds obvious, yet protein is often overlooked when people experience hair loss. Someone can take every hair supplement on the market, but the body still needs enough total protein and essential amino acids to construct the hair shaft.

I centered my diet around high-quality animal proteins, including:

  • beef
  • eggs
  • poultry
  • fish and seafood
  • pork
  • complete animal-based protein powders when convenient

Animal proteins provide all nine essential amino acids and are rich in nutrients such as vitamin B12, zinc, selenium, iron, and leucine.

During periods of inadequate calories or protein, the body may reduce resources devoted to nonessential processes such as hair growth. Hair is important to us emotionally, but it is not necessary for immediate survival. The body will prioritize the brain, heart, organs, and immune system first.

Eating enough complete protein helped ensure my body had the raw materials needed for new growth.

Vitamin D Was Another Piece of the Puzzle

Vitamin D receptors are present in hair follicles, and low vitamin D status has been observed in several types of hair loss. That does not mean vitamin D alone will regrow everyone’s hair, but a deficiency is worth identifying and correcting.

I tested my vitamin D level rather than blindly taking a large dose. Once I knew where I stood, I used an appropriate amount and continued monitoring it.

Like iron, vitamin D is an example of why laboratory testing matters. The goal is to correct a deficiency—not assume that increasingly high doses will produce increasingly better hair. Electrolytes Supported Hydration and Circulation

I also became more intentional about electrolytes, particularly sodium, potassium, and magnesium.

Electrolytes help maintain fluid balance, blood volume, nerve signaling, and muscle function. Proper hydration supports healthy circulation throughout the body and scalp, including delivery of oxygen and nutrients to tissues.

I do not think of electrolytes as a direct cure for hair loss, and there is not strong evidence that an electrolyte drink specifically increases scalp circulation enough to regrow hair. However, dehydration and inadequate sodium can contribute to lightheadedness, low blood volume, and poor exercise tolerance—especially on a ketogenic or low-carbohydrate diet.

For me, adequate fluids and electrolytes were part of improving the internal environment that supported recovery.

How Red Light Works for Hair Loss
  • Boosts cellular energy: Increases ATP production in hair follicle mitochondria.
  • Improves blood flow: Widens blood vessels to deliver more oxygen and nutrients to the roots.
  • Prolonging growth: Keeps follicles in the active anagen growth phase longer and shifts dormant follicles out of the resting phase.

Red light was not a replacement for fixing iron or hormones. It was an additional follicle-support strategy layered on top of the fundamentals.

To use red light therapy effectively for hair growth, expose a clean, product-free scalp to wavelengths between 620–680 nm. Part your hair into sections to ensure the light hits the skin directly, use the device 3 to 5 times per week for 10 to 20 minutes, and remain consistent for 4 to 6 months.
Preparing the Scalp
  • Start clean: Wash and dry your hair before your session. Oils, dry shampoo, and styling products block light from reaching the follicles.
  • Part your hair: Hair strands can shadow the scalp. Use a comb or your fingers to part hair into rows or quadrants so the diodes touch or shine directly on the skin. 
Timing and Schedule
  • Session length: Aim for 10 to 20 minutes for caps, helmets, or panels, or 2 to 5 minutes per zone if using a targeted brush.
  • Frequency: Do treatments 3 to 5 times per week. Leave at least 12 to 24 hours between sessions to let cells process the energy.
  • Be patient: Expect less shedding around 8 to 12 weeks, with visible density changes appearing between 16 and 26 weeks.

Scalp Microneedling Helped Stimulate the Follicles

Microneedling creates controlled microinjuries in the scalp. This may activate wound-healing pathways and improve the response to certain topical treatments.

Research on hair loss suggests microneedling may improve hair-growth outcomes, particularly when used alongside better-established therapies. However, technique matters. Needling too deeply, too frequently, or under unclean conditions can cause inflammation, infection, scarring, and worsening hair loss.

I treated microneedling as a procedure—not a casual beauty trend. I paid close attention to sanitation, healing time, needle depth, and scalp irritation.

More injury does not mean more growth.

Hair Regrowth and Hair Repair Are Not the Same

Correcting iron, improving nutrition, using red light, and treating hormone issues may support what grows from the scalp. None of those interventions can truly restore a severely damaged section of hair to its original biological condition because the visible hair shaft is no longer living tissue.

That is why I also needed a separate plan for the damaged hair already on my head.

Bond-repair treatments helped reduce breakage, improve softness, and make my hair appear healthier while I waited for stronger new growth to replace the damaged lengths.

Protect Your Hair While You Sleep

Hair repair doesn’t stop when you go to bed. In fact, some of the simplest habits during the night can make a noticeable difference in reducing breakage and preserving the healthy hair you’re working so hard to grow.

One of the best changes I made was sleeping with a silk sleep cap. Unlike cotton pillowcases, silk creates much less friction as your hair moves throughout the night. Less friction means fewer tangles, less breakage, reduced frizz, and less stress on fragile strands that are already recovering from damage. If you don’t like wearing a sleep cap, a silk or satin pillowcase is another excellent option, although a cap provides the most consistent protection.

Never Go to Bed With Wet Hair

Going to bed with wet hair may seem harmless, but wet hair is actually at its weakest. Water causes the hair shaft to swell, making it more elastic and more vulnerable to stretching, friction, and breakage.

As you toss and turn during the night, those weakened strands rub against your pillow, increasing the likelihood of split ends, frizz, and broken hairs. Sleeping with damp hair can also leave the scalp warm and moist for prolonged periods, which may contribute to scalp irritation in susceptible individuals.

Instead, allow your hair to dry completely before going to bed. If you use a blow dryer, choose a lower heat setting and always use a heat protectant to minimize additional damage.

Skip the Biotin Unless You Have a Proven Deficiency

Biotin has become one of the most heavily marketed supplements for hair growth, but the science tells a different story.

True biotin deficiency is extremely rare in otherwise healthy people eating a balanced diet. While biotin supplementation can dramatically improve hair and nail problems in someone who is genuinely deficient, there is very little evidence that taking large doses improves hair growth in people with normal biotin levels.

Perhaps more importantly, high-dose biotin supplements can interfere with many common laboratory tests. They can produce falsely abnormal thyroid test results, making it appear as though someone has hyperthyroidism or other thyroid disorders when their thyroid function is actually normal. Biotin can also interfere with certain cardiac, hormone, and vitamin laboratory tests, potentially leading to unnecessary testing or inappropriate treatment.

Rather than automatically taking biotin, focus on identifying the real cause of your hair loss. Iron deficiency, hormonal changes, thyroid disease, inadequate protein intake, illness, medications, stress, and nutritional deficiencies are all far more common contributors to hair thinning than a lack of biotin.

Healthy hair starts with a healthy body. Supporting your hair with adequate protein, correcting nutrient deficiencies confirmed by blood work, optimizing hormones when appropriate, protecting your hair from unnecessary damage, and practicing good hair care habits will have a much greater impact than taking a supplement you likely don’t need.

Hair Recovery Takes Time

Hair growth is slow. Correcting the underlying problem does not cause an immediate visual transformation because follicles must transition through their normal growth cycle.

It can take several months before reduced shedding becomes noticeable and even longer before new growth creates a visible improvement in density and length.

I tracked progress through photographs rather than judging my hair every morning. Day-to-day changes were almost impossible to see, but pictures taken under similar lighting over several months showed the improvement much more clearly.
